Taghkanic Woodworking is a custom cabinetry and millwork shop in Pawling, New York, run by master woodworker Leland Thomasset, who started the business in his garage in 1989 building custom beds and cabinets before growing it into a full shop that also does business as Pawling Closet Company. The work today centers on custom cabinets, kitchen and bathroom cabinetry, walk-in closets and cabinet doors, built with CNC machining alongside traditional woodworking. On Houzz, the company carries a 5.0-star rating from seven ratings, and it's an active member of the Cabinet Makers Association. Procore Construction Network lists finish carpentry as its specialty, matching the hands-on cabinetry and millwork work the company is known for in the trade press. One thing worth confirming before booking: the business goes by two names β Taghkanic Woodworking and Pawling Closet Company β so make sure any quote or contract names the entity you're actually working with.
